Constantini2-11 at 2021 LGT World Women's Curling Championship

Apr 30 - May 9, 2021

Trentino, Italy
Games: 13  
Record: 2W - 11L  
PF/G: 6.03  
PA/G: 8.62  
Hammer Efficiency: 0.20  
Steal Defense: 0.21  
Force Efficiency: 0.38  
Steal Efficiency: 0.22  

 
Stefania Constantini (Trentino, ITA) finished 2-11 in the 0-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Constantini lost
7-5 to Anna Kubeskova (Prague, CZE), droppimg another game, 9-2 to Silvana Tirinzoni (Aarau, SUI). Constantini lost 8-5 to Alina Kovaleva (St. Petersburg, RCF). Constantini lost 7-5 to Tabitha Peterson (Chaska, USA) where Constantini responded with a 10-6 win over Daniela Jentsch (Fuessen, GER). Constantini went on to lose 7-6 against EunJung Kim (Gangneung, KOR). Constantini lost 9-6 to Eve Muirhead (Stirling, SCO). Constantini lost 10-4 to Kerri Einarson (Gimli, CAN) where Constantini responded with a 11-5 win over Marie Turmann (Tallinn, EST). Constantini went on to lose 9-5 against Madeleine Dupont (Hvidovre, DEN). Constantini lost 8-2 to Sayaka Yoshimura (Sapporo, JPN). Constantini lost 6-4 to Yu Han (Beijing, CHN). Constantini lost 9-5 to Anna Hasselborg (Sundbyberg, SWE) in their final qualifying round match.
